Output 8fbda0f4c31940c95daf752310e6ccfbec9ab239bc4816b1f6ac49f8f6787b31:0

value
331805123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b450927d0c33fea42268ce0539d59be0809101d7 OP_EQUAL
address
3J8S5L3t35WtR9MqWf1D8oL6SxKwJjDZCe
transaction
8fbda0f4c31940c95daf752310e6ccfbec9ab239bc4816b1f6ac49f8f6787b31
spent
true